For the weekly sync: the Meridian two-way calendar sync hit a conflict storm last week when the Tallow tenant's connector replayed stale events, locking the sync service account after repeated auth failures. While locked, conflicts queue but do not resolve; users see duplicate events. Recovery: pause the connector, drain the conflict queue to the holding table, then unlock the account through the offline console. Do not restart the connector before unlock completes. The console requires the recovery passphrase recorded immediately below.

unlock words, tawep-fahog: casir-kasion-rusius-silael-ralax-frair-belius-quenmir-oliix-quenir-gorwyn-praion-casion-wenix

// Per-tenant rate quotas are enforced by the Quotaline service, not here.
// This client only reads quota state; writes go through the Ledgerbird pipeline.
// Do not cache quota responses longer than 30s or enforcement drifts.
// The client authenticates to Quotaline with the key below.

API key for tagef-fafop: vxb2-ta

If Pindrop telemetry payloads exceed 256 KB, compression kicks in automatically; do not disable it under load. Check the agent log for zstd level downgrades — repeated downgrades mean CPU pressure, so scale the Orvane collectors first. Confirm ingestion lag clears before closing the page. Record the build token shown below.

pipeline stamp: htk21_86b657ac0aa916a9af17f

Welcome to Ostermoor Systems. Please note an ongoing recall of the Venlitch V2 door sensors fitted on floors two and five. Affected doors may not register badge taps on the first attempt; wait two seconds and retry rather than forcing the handle. Replacement units arrive next month. Until then, if a sensor fails entirely, use the manual keypad with the code below.

badge for fafop-fajof: bdg-Z-47